DESCRIPTION:Collaborate\, create\, make change here. \nSTREETS\, the street theatre ensemble of NACL Theatre is welcoming new participants (age thirteen and up) to join FREE  rehearsals and trainings every Thursday evening upstairs at The Western Ballroom in Callicoon NY at 6 PM.  \nDirected by Tannis Kowalchuk\, the community ensemble is creating a series of spectacular short outdoor plays entitled SMALL MIRACLES to tour to a variety of outdoor events\, parades and festivals in the region. Issues and performance themes of interest for the group include ecology\, public land\, bullying and violence\, welcoming strangers\, depression\, connections\, and activism. \nThe weekly trainings include activities such as group theatre exercises\, group singing\, stilt walking for those who want to try\, performance composition\, set and prop construction\, writing and design.   \nThe project encourages people to connect with others\, build a team\, challenge themselves\, and together create beautiful performance art that is designed to spark ideas\, entertain\, and bring forth change for a better world.   \nTaking place every Thursday from 6-8:30 PM at the Western in Callicoon\, NY. participants should wear clothes to move in and bring paper and pen. DESCRIPTION:Ever wonder how the trails stay open and passable? Where do those colored marks on the trees come from? Take this workshop to find out! \nTrail Maintenance is clearing\, cleaning\, and blazing. Trail maintainers use small hand tools to clip and cut brush out of the trail\, remove debris from drainage structures\, and paint or hang the markers used for route finding also known as blazes. \nThis course helps you gain or brush up on the skills necessary to a Trail Conference Trail Maintainer Volunteer.  Skills include how to clip trail corridors\, clean drainage structures\, proper blazing techniques\, and reporting trail conditions. \nThere will be a field component of this course\, so be sure you wear your sturdy hiking boots and work gloves if you have them!
